Date:07-OCT-2009
Time:11:06 LT
Type:Silhouette image of generic MG23 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different
MiG-23UB
Operator:Libyan Air Force
Registration: 8423
C/n / msn: V65-021
Fatalities:Fatalities: 2 / Occupants: 2
Other fatalities:0
Airplane damage: Written off (damaged beyond repair)
Location:2km from Mitiga Airport, Tripoli -   Libya
Phase: Manoeuvring (airshow, firefighting, ag.ops.)
Nature:Military
Departure airport:Mitiga Airport
Destination airport:Mitiga Airport
Narrative:
Crashed during the airshow Lavex 2009. The jet was flying a low level as it was taking part in the air show. It went down when its nose dived hitting a one storey house. Two women were lightly injured as a result one of them was hospitalized for a check up and then released from hospital.
